We are pleased to announce that ReDat Recording Systems have been successfully deployed at Cat Bi International Airport (Hai Phong, Vietnam). Our technology provides comprehensive recording of air traffic controllers’s communication — from voice calls to screen recordings.

From 22 to 26 September 2025, the VOTE-31 and WG-67 Meeting 56 conferences will take place at Jotron’s headquarters in Larvik, Norway. The focus will be on the standardisation of air traffic management technologies and the development of the VoIP standard in aviation.
